The cheapest way to get from Leeds to Woolacombe is to bus which costs £35 - £65 and takes 11h 16m.
The fastest way to get from Leeds to Woolacombe is to drive which takes 5h 34m and costs £70 - £110.
No, there is no direct bus from Leeds station to Woolacombe. However, there are services departing from Leeds City Bus & Coach Station and arriving at Sands via Bus Station, Bus Station and St James' Place Gardens.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 11h 16m.
The distance between Leeds and Woolacombe is 331 miles. The road distance is 291.5 miles.
The best way to get from Leeds to Woolacombe without a car is to train which takes 6h 44m and costs £160 - £440.
It takes approximately 6h 44m to get from Leeds to Woolacombe, including transfers.
